Transaction 2b28ee793dc9d8272f016ae4dd72919546c2a3d7b53b9f84e46886f762375574

1 Input
1 Outputs
  • 2b28ee793dc9d8272f016ae4dd72919546c2a3d7b53b9f84e46886f762375574:0
  • value  65716642
    address  31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z